About the area

The Office of Research Enterprise is responsible for formulating and providing policy advice, and for developing and implementing initiatives to effectively solicit, coordinate and administer externally and internally funded research activities which enhance the University’s research reputation.

The Research Ethics & Integrity team is responsible for ensuring the University upholds the highest ethical standards in conducting research with integrity. It is responsible for ensuring that UWA research complies with the relevant Commonwealth and State regulatory frameworks when working with animals, human research, genetically modified organisms (GMOs), defence related research and foreign interference.

About the opportunity 

  • Lead and provide strategic oversight of operations in the management of the Research Ethics team, whose core responsibility is to ensure that teaching and research protocols that use animals, human participants and bio-hazardous materials comply with relevant Legislative and Regulatory requirements and are approved through the University committees established for this purpose.  
  • Provide authoritative, institution-wide strategic advice and set the policy direction and governance frameworks relating to research ethics and integrity. This includes the principles that guide research and ethical standards which set the framework of sound research practise in conducting research on Indigenous land, with Indigenous peoples or their cultural elements, the use of animals and human participants, and the use of bio-hazardous materials including genetically modified organisms (GMOs).
  • Design and deliver a high performing team culture by educating and training the university community of appropriate research integrity and ethical research practice.

About you

  • Relevant Postgraduate Qualification in research or demonstrated equivalent experience working within the tertiary higher education system or a research-intensive environment.
  • Comprehensive and significant knowledge of the Australia higher education research governance and compliance environment, including the expectations of the NHMRC and ARC, reporting obligations to funders, and the interfaces with human research ethics, animal ethics and biosafety governance.
  • Extensive management experience at an appropriate level, with a demonstrated ability to provide high level, effective leadership, motivation and direction to significant teams of staff.
  • Experience conducting or overseeing assessments and investigations under a procedural fairness framework.
  • Capability to lead the integrity function operationally, including supervising staff and advisers, maintaining reliable case management and records, and reporting on trends to governance committees.
